Banff and Lake Louise
Banff townsite is about 25 minutes away; Lake Louise and Moraine Lake roughly an hour. Canada's most-visited national park is on the doorstep.
Skiing
Three resorts within an hour - Mt Norquay, Sunshine Village, and Lake Louise - plus Nakiska in Kananaskis Country.
Silvertip golf
The 18-hole Silvertip mountain course is minutes from the door, with some of the largest elevation changes in the Rockies.
Trails and the Bow Valley
Grassi Lakes, Ha Ling Peak, and the valley trails start minutes from town - hiking and biking in summer, Nordic skiing and fat biking in winter.
Downtown Canmore
Main Street restaurants, cafes, and breweries, with the Bow River a short walk away - about ten minutes from the house.
Getting there
Calgary International Airport is about an hour east by car, straight along the Trans-Canada.
